人工智能(AI)是一种模拟人类智能的技术,它通过学习、推理和自我优化来执行任务。在实现这一目标的过程中,AI系统需要大量的数据作为输入。这些数据可以是结构化的,如文本、图像或音频,也可以是非结构化的,如视频或传感器数据。以下是关于AI如何存储大量数据的一些详细信息:
1. 数据类型:AI系统可以处理各种类型的数据,包括结构化数据(如数据库中的表格数据)和非结构化数据(如文本、图像、音频和视频)。这些数据为AI提供了丰富的信息来源,使其能够理解和处理复杂的现实世界问题。
2. 数据存储:为了有效地存储和管理大量数据,AI系统通常使用分布式文件系统(如Hadoop HDFS或Amazon S3)来存储数据。这些系统允许多个计算机节点共享和访问数据,从而提高了数据的可用性和可扩展性。此外,一些高级AI系统还使用专门的数据库管理系统(如Google BigQuery或Spark SQL)来存储结构化数据。
3. 数据预处理:在将数据输入AI模型之前,需要进行预处理步骤,以消除噪声、填补缺失值、标准化特征等。这有助于提高模型的性能和准确性。预处理过程通常涉及数据清洗、特征工程和数据转换等操作。
4. 数据增强:为了提高模型的泛化能力,可以使用数据增强技术来生成新的训练样本。这可以通过旋转、缩放、裁剪、颜色变换等方法来实现。数据增强可以帮助AI系统更好地适应不同的应用场景和数据分布。
5. 数据隐私与安全:随着对数据隐私和安全的关注日益增加,AI系统需要确保存储的数据符合相关的法律法规和政策要求。这可能包括数据加密、访问控制和审计跟踪等措施。
6. 数据更新与维护:AI系统需要定期更新和维护其数据集,以确保模型的准确性和性能。这可能涉及到数据收集、数据清洗、模型训练和模型评估等步骤。
总之,AI系统确实需要存储大量的数据,这些数据对于实现AI的目标至关重要。通过有效的数据管理和预处理,AI系统可以充分利用这些数据资源,从而在各个领域取得显著的成果。